2014 Moto Guzzi Norge purchased new in 2016. Only 1437 miles on it. Like new. Never dropped, dented or scratched. Power windshield, heated grips, ABS, runs like a clock. The only modifications to this bike are that I had the catalytic converter removed and had a new "Y" pipe put on. Runs better, and you don't have a heater box sitting at your ankles anymore. I also raised the handlebars about 1 inch. Much nicer on your shoulders and neck. Have all original parts if someone wants to convert anything back to completely stock. You will also note in the pics, that I have a Moto Guzzi handlebar pouch up front too. Nice for little things like glasses, gloves, cell phones, etc. This bike is also wired for a battery tender. Finally, I have a pair of Honda Goldwing footpegs for this bike which I have not installed. These pegs are lower and wider than the stock Guzzi pegs and reportedly much more comfortable.
